Brief summary

A double-blind, randomized controlled study is designed to assess the analgesic effect of a single intravenous dose of 2 g of magnesium dipyrone (metamizol) and whether the administration of the active drug will be associated with changes in plasma beta-endorphin immunoreactivity values in patients undergoing elective inguinal herniorrhaphy (Bassini operation) under epidural anesthesia. Participants, care givers, and those assessing the outcomes will be blinded to group assignment. Participants will be randomized to receive dipyrone or a placebo. The active drug or placebo will be administered as an intravenous infusion over 10 min. Pain will be evaluated by the patient according to a 100-mm visual analogue scale. Assessments will be carried out the day before surgery, immediately after operation, at the time of drug administration, and 60 and 180 min after treatment. At the same time as pain will be evaluated, blood samples will be drawn for plasma beta-endorphin immunoreactivity measurement (immunoradiometric assay).

Interventions

DRUGDipyrone administration

Dipyrone 2 g (Nolotil®, Europharma, Madrid, Spain); one ampoule in 50 mL of 0.9% saline solution as an intravenous infusion over 10 min.

BEHAVIORALPain assessment

Pain will be evaluated by the patient according to a 100-mm visual analogue scale (VAS) (from point 0 no pain to point 10 unbearable pain).

BIOLOGICALbeta-endorphin immunoreactivity

Plasma beta-EPIr levels will be measured by an immunoradiometric assay (Allegro Beta-endorphin, Nichols Institute Diagnostics, SAN JUAN DE CAPISTRANO, CA) (normal values 29-40 pg/mL). It will be obtained by venous blood samples (5 mL) at the same time points at pain will be measured.

OTHERPlacebo administration

Placebo in 50 mL of 0.9% saline solution as an intravenous infusion over 10 min.

Inclusion criteria

* 18-70 years, elective surgery, routine laboratory tests (blood cell count, biochemical profile, urinalysis), chest radiography, twelve-lead electrocardiography, body mass index (BMI), blood pressure, pulse rate normal or abnormal values without clinical relevance and a mental status sufficient to be able to complete efficacy tests.

Exclusion criteria

* Patients who had taken other analgesics or anti-inflammatory drugs 24 h before surgery, as those with known hypersensitivity to the drug or with any other disorder contradicting the administration of dipyrone. Patients with hypersensitivity to non-steroidal anti-inflammatory agents.
